So, what will you be getting if you decide to bite the bullet and buy the Hisense A6BG? Well, for starters, a 4K UHD TV that supports all four of the key HDR formats – Dolby Vision, HDR10, HDR10+ and HLG – which is something of a rarity at this kind of price point.

To back up that wide-ranging HDR support is support for DTS Virtual:X – an audio format that aims to create the feeling of surround sound using virtualisation algorithms. It’s no match for Dolby Atmos but certainly helps improve the sonic performance of less powerful in-built TV speakers.

Gamers will be pleased to see the inclusion of a Game Mode that reduces latency, though those with a PlayStation 5 or Xbox Series X will have to temper their expectations – this is a cheap TV with a refresh rate limited to 60Hz so there’s no 4K@120Hz or Variable Refresh Rate. There is, however, a sports mode that automatically engages when the TV picks up a sports signal and seeks to recreate an audio experience akin to that of being in a stadium.

These features are underpinned by a simple-to-use operating system – VIDAA U – that provides access to most of the streaming services we know and love, including Disney+, YouTube and Netflix.
